Harris County officials are seeking assistance from the public in locating 55-year-old Jimmy Deffenebaugh, who was last seen on February 2. Deffenebaugh’s disappearance has prompted a search effort by authorities in the area.

Last Known Location and Description

Jimmy Deffenebaugh was last seen leaving his residence in the Cutten Green subdivision. He was reportedly riding a bicycle at the time of his disappearance. Deffenebaugh was described as wearing a white Chevron hat, a black hoodie, blue jeans, an orange reflector vest, and black shoes.
